On Monday 12 May 2008 11:50:15 elvin ibbotson wrote:
> If, for
> example, the feature types were structured using a numerical system
> such that so that all natural features began with 0, all highways
> with 1, etc, but everything needed at scales smaller than 5 ended
> with numbers smaller than 3 (eg. coastlines: 01; trunk roads: 12) I
> could make a simple call for features less than *3.
Like already pointed out before:
This only works if your idea of important is the same as the idea of important
of the ones that did the initial ordering. However for a motorist a motorway
is the most important road, for a cyclist a cycleway is the most important
road and for a canal boater roads are not important at all.
